Arm released the next generation of its mobile compute platform, CSS for Mobile 2. CSS is the form in which Arm pre-integrates CPU, GPU and system blocks and then licenses the bundle to chipmakers. This generation's C2 Ultra CPU carries the SME2 matrix extension for on-device AI, while the Mali G2-Ultra NX folds neural acceleration directly into the graphics pipeline, using AI to reconstruct detail and interpolate frames (Arm, 2026-09-08; Arm, 2026-09-08). ⚠️ First-party announcements in marketing register; we found no platform performance figures in the free material, and the only number is "more than 14 billion Mali units shipped to date", which is a cumulative historical total rather than an annual rate. Read it alongside the first "Also happened" item: if Intel really does exit the low end and embedded, the beneficiaries that report names are MediaTek and Qualcomm, both in the Arm camp.
